When you call for electrical help, a few things influence the final bill. The biggest factor is the scope of the project—swapping out a basic outlet is a quick task, while rewiring a room or upgrading an old panel requires much more labor and time. The age of your home also plays a role, as older wiring often needs extra care to meet current safety standards. Parts and material quality also change the total cost. Typically, electricians focus on the electrical systems within a home or business. While they install and repair electrical components for HVAC units, they generally don't handle the actual heating and cooling mechanisms themselves. That's usually a job for a specialized HVAC technician. An electrician can ensure the power supply to your HVAC system is safe and functional.
An electrician is a tradesperson who specializes in the electrical wiring of buildings, stationary machines, and related equipment. They are responsible for install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ical systems, ensuring everything is safe and up to code. This includes everything from lighting and outlets to complex control systems.
